Specific heat
In the foot-pound-second system, the amount of heat (Btu) required to
raise 1 pound of a substance 1 F. In the centimeter-gram-second system, the
amount of heat (cal) required to raise 1 pound of substance 1 C. For
example, the specific heat of water is 1 and the specific heat of air is
.24.
